PIN for Primary Medical (General Practice) Services in East Berkshire

The following is a Prior Information Notice (PIN) only and is being placed to alert providers to a potential future procurement exercise. Any values and timescales stated within this PIN are for guideline purposes only and should not be taken as a guarantee. NHS East Berkshire Clinical Commissioning Group (EBCCG) is seeking expressions of interest from suitably qualified providers for a potential opportunity for the provision of a new Primary Medical (GP) Service in Bracknell. The outcome of this PIN will inform the procurement options to secure a service provider for the new population where housing growth and development has identified a significant increase in the patient population. The service will build on existing best practice, and focus on a community and health and social care approach. The clinical services will be delivered in an environment that provides patient care of a standard consistent with that of similar services provided elsewhere within east Berkshire. The annual contract value will be based on the global sum equivalent value for 2019/20 (as stipulated in the NHS GMS statement of financial entitlements) and would be reflective of the actual population list size through the planned housing development. The projected population for this area is as follows (taken from the Bracknell Forest Council local Development Plan Strategic Sites Allocation 2017): Table 1: Anticipated Housing Growth: 5,271 dwellings to be built between 2019 and 2034. Format: Year, Additional patients (based on 2.24 patients per dwelling), Additional patients (based on 2.4 patients per dwelling) 2019-2024 2,708 2,902 2025-2030 7,453 7,985 2031-2034 1,646 1,764 Total 11,807 12,651 upto 2036* 2,688 2,880 2036 & beyond* 6,272 6,720 Total 20,767 22,251 *Warfield phase 3: *If Warfield phase 3 takes effect, this will increase the planned population by a further 4,000 dwellings (1,200 up to 2036 and 2,800 2036 and beyond). This is likely to be a gradual population growth due to the continuing housing development. The annual contract value will change depending on the number of patients registered for the new service. The value listed also excludes additional income that can be earned via direct enhanced services, quality and outcomes framework and CCG-commissioned local incentives. The successful provider is expected to be fully operational, providing services from the Blue Mountain Community Health and Wellbeing Centre, Binfield, Bracknell, Berkshire on completion of the development in 2021/2022.
